When visiting Chicago with a rental car from O’Hare International Airport, travelers are presented with a unique opportunity to explore both the vibrant cityscape and the picturesque surrounding regions. Upon departing the airport, the well-connected expressways—such as Interstate 90 and 294—offer a straightforward route to downtown Chicago, where iconic landmarks await, including the Willis Tower, Millennium Park, and the Art Institute of Chicago. A rental car provides the flexibility to navigate the city’s diverse neighborhoods, each showcasing its distinct cultural flavor, from the historic streets of Hyde Park to the trendy boutiques of Wicker Park. Additionally, a day trip north to Lake Geneva or south to the charming town of Oak Park, home to Frank Lloyd Wright’s architectural masterpieces, becomes effortlessly attainable. The scenic drive along Lake Shore Drive also allows visitors to enjoy stunning views of Lake Michigan. FAQ Airport Car Rental

How do I find the rental counter?

Your voucher will display the rental company’s address and provide directions to the counter.

At airports, look for signs featuring a car with a key above it. They may also indicate ‘Rent a car’ or ‘Car rental’.

How do I drop the car off at the end of my rental?

Simply ask the counter staff when you pick up your car.

If no one is available when you need to return the car, such as during late hours, there may be a ‘drop box’ for the key. Confirm this with the counter staff at pick-up.

It’s always advisable to keep any paperwork provided to you.

What happens if my flight is delayed or cancelled?

If you have provided your flight details during booking, the rental company may track your flight and hold your car for a grace period in case of delays or cancellations, though this is not guaranteed.

Details about any grace period can be found under ‘Important information’ and then ‘Grace period’ in your rental terms.

If your flight is delayed or cancelled, notify the rental company as soon as possible using the phone number on your rental voucher.

How do I pay for my car?

When booking your car, you can use most credit or debit cards for payment (accepted cards will be specified).

However, few rental companies accept debit cards for the security deposit at the rental counter. Therefore, the main driver typically needs to present a credit card in their own name when picking up the car. It does not need to be the same card used for the booking.

What do I need to take to pick the car up?

The main driver must bring:

  1. A credit card in their own name with sufficient funds for the deposit (some rental companies may accept debit cards).
  2. A valid driving license held for at least two years (some companies may require longer).
  3. Your voucher.

Additional documents may be required in some cases, and always will be communicated beforehand by your local car rental company before you arrive at the airport.

If other drivers will be using the car, they must also present their driving licenses.

Important: Without all necessary documents, the counter staff will not release the car. Please review the rental terms under ‘What you need at pick-up’.

How can I rent a car if I’m under 30?

When searching for a car, deselect the option that specifies the driver is between 30-65 years old and enter your age.

The system will display cars available for your age group.

Please note:

  1. Very few companies rent cars to individuals under 21.
  2. Drivers under 25 may incur a young driver fee.
  3. Most rental companies require a valid driving license held for at least two years (some may require longer).
